Floppy Friends Horse Toys
|
|
About 300 Floppy Friends Horse Toys have been recalled by Toy
Investments Inc., d/b/a Toysmith, of Auburn, Wash., because surface
paints contain excessive lead.
The recalled horse toy has a push-up base. When the base is pushed up,
the toy horse is floppy. When released, the toy horse stands up
straight. The horse is brown and white, and the base is green with
orange, red and dark blue flowers.
Manufactured in China, it was sold at hobby stores, gas stations, gift
shops and toy stores nationwide from February 2008 through April 2008
for about $4.

American Scientific Magnets
|
|
About 87,000 American Scientific magnets have been recalled, after
being sold primarily to schools, because the paint on the magnets
contains excessive lead.
This recall involves horseshoe, rectangular bar and U-shaped magnets
sold primarily to schools for use in science classes. The magnets have
red and blue paint on the surface. Item numbers included in the recall
are:
Item Number: Description (Sizes)
- 3101-01, 02, 20: Bar-shaped Steel (75mm x 12mm x 5mm, 100mm x 12mm x 5mm, 150mm x 19mm x 7mm, 200mm, 150mm X 15mm X 10mm)
- 3102-01, 02, 03, 04: Horseshoe-shaped Steel (50mm, 75mm, 100mm, 150mm)
- 3106-04, 06: Pair of Bar-shaped Aluminum/Nickel/Cobalt (100mm X 10mm X 7mm, 150mm X 19mm X 7mm)
- 3108-01: Horseshoe-shaped Aluminum/Nickel/Cobalt
- 3126-06: Pair of Economy, Bar-shaped Aluminum/Nickel/Cobalt
- AR-110: U-shaped (3.5 inches)
- N38 (3126-07): Bar-shaped (37mm)
The item numbers are located on the product's packaging.
Manufactured in India, the magnets were sold to independent
distributors nationwide from October 2006 through February 2008 for
between $1 and $4.

About 900 Sure Grip paintbrushes have been recalled by Early Childhood
Resources LLC, of Mt. Laurel, N.J., because of excessive lead paint on
the yellow handle.
The paintbrushes were sold in multicolor packages of four. Only the
yellow brushes are included in the recall. The paintbrushes have a
rounded cylinder body with tan bristle tip brushes and measure about 4
inches in height.
Manufactured in China, the paintbrushes were sold by Early Childhood
Resource distributors, including teacher supply stores nationwide, from
May 2007 through December 2007 for about $4.

Basic Beat Shaker Guiro Instruments
|
|
About 6,500 Basic Beat Shaker Guiro Instruments have been recalled by
Antigua Winds Inc., of San Antonio, Texas, because the paint contains
excessive levels of lead.
The recalled shaker guiro is a ridged, cylinder-shaped percussion
instrument that contains beads and is played by scraping a stick along
the surface. The shaker guiro measures about 2 inches wide by 5 inches
long. One end of the instrument is painted red, and the other end is
painted blue. The center section and stick are natural wood. 'Basic
Beat 5'' Guiro/Shaker,' 'SHBB5,' and 'Recommended for Ages 6+' are
printed on the packaging.
Manufactured in Taiwan, the instruments were sold by West Music retail
stores in Iowa and Illinois, the West Music catalog, online at
westmusic.com, and West Music booths at conventions and workshops
nationwide, the Music Together Catalog, and musictogether.com from
November 2001 through March 2008 for between $9 and $11.

Disney is recalling about 8,000 Tinker Bell Wands imported by Hoop
Retail Stores LLC, of Secaucus, N.J., because the paint on the pearl
beads in the flowers on the wands has excessive lead.
The recalled Tinker Bell wands are green and light up and sound when a
button in the handle is pressed. The top of the wand has white plastic
flowers, a green bow and a pin with Tinker Bell's face on it.
Manufactured in China, the wands were sold at Disney stores nationwide from April 2007 through October 2007 for about $13.

Pirates of the Caribbean Sleeping Bag
|
|
Disney Store has recalled about 4,100 Pirates of the Caribbean Sleeping
Bags, imported by Hoop Retail Stores LLC, of Secaucus, N.J., because
the surface paint on the zipper has excessive lead.
The recalled Pirates of the Caribbean sleeping bags have a cartoon
pirate design of Davy Jones and Jack Sparrow on the front. Style number
F1652B0003 is printed on the logo label inside the sleeping bags. The
sleeping bag with the skull art design is not included in this recall.
Manufactured in China, they were sold exclusively at Disney stores
nationwide from April 2007 through October 2007 for about $25.
